I was commissioned in December 1999, branched
Infantry and finally have taken a knee to drink some
water. My IOBC, Ranger school, and subsequent
training (Air Assault, EIB, NTC, JRTC x2) at Ft
Campbell has served me well. As a branch detail
Infantry Lt I served with the 101st ABN
as a platoon leader and rifle company XO. I
transitioned into the Finance branch and served a
brief period at Fort Campbell's Military Pay
Office. From there I served as the Aide-de-Camp for
the 24th Infantry Division?s ADC-F
(Forward since the main HQ is at Ft Riley) which is
responsible for the training and readiness oversight
of three National Guard Enhanced Separate Brigades (ESB).
Two of which served a year in Iraq. Currently I am
the commander of Bravo Detachment 106th
Finance located in Vilseck Germany. As the
commander I am responsible for providing finance
support to all Soldiers and civilians within my area
(Vilseck, Grafenwoehr & Hohenfels). I also have
experience with logistics, as my prior service time
(8 years) was spent as a Supply Sergeant working
unit supply rooms through Brigade S4 and PBO. I am
married and have three children. I can honestly say
the Army has always been a demanding yet rewarding
experience. No other place can offer what the
military can in terms of developing individuals and
instilling a sense of camaraderie.

My
name is 1LT Timothy D. Tyner and I graduated from the mighty mountain
ranger battalion in May 2002. I was branched into the
Signal Corps against my wishes but have found that
this really is the place to be. I am currently sitting
in the middle of the McGregor Military Missile Range and Maneuver
Area. This email is only possible via a direct like to
our DOIM and into a Node Center. My current unit is
HHB 3rd Battalion (PATRIOT) 2ndAir Defense Artillery
stationed here at lovely Fort Bliss, Texas. We are part
of the 31st Air Defense Artillery Brigade that
directly supports III(US) Corps. The PATRIOT Missile
system is very reliant on UHF and SINCGARS
communications and as such my platoon is responsible
for all the relay traffic from the line batteries to
the battalion. It is an interesting job but also very
boring at times. We sit in the middle of the dessert
and wait for something to happen. My platoon has 27
soldiers and my February everyone of my NCO's will be
gone to Korea, Recruiting, Germany, etc. Upon
arrival to Fort Bliss our unit was put on a warning
order which soon became a deployment order for
Operation Iraqi Freedom. That order was soon cancelled
when our battalion commander was relieved, cause,
still unknown to us joes. Since being stationed at
Fort Bliss I have had the opportunity to learn a whole
new set of Signal Operations and the fact that without
Signal support, nothing happens. When the shots are in
we are loved, the second they go down, well that is
the bad part of Signal. All in all I am very happy
with the Signal Corps, other than Fort Bliss. A fellow
LT from our sister battalion described Fort Bliss and
Iraq as being much the same. Both are exceptionally
hot, both are deserts, and in both places you can't
understand the natives! Just remember that where ever
you are that PATRIOT will watch over you. Trust me, I
was very skeptical at first but the system does work,
sometimes. Well that's about it. Getting married in
June time frame. Still don't know if the Army is for
me or not but I have lots of time to see. Hope
all are doing well and staying safe. Take care, God
Bless, and MRB 4LIFE.
